What companies run services between Piccadilly Circus Underground Station, England and Chelsea Flower Show, London, England?

Arriva UK operates a bus from Trocadero / Haymarket to Walpole Street every 5 minutes. Tickets cost £1–3 and the journey takes 23 min. Alternatively, London Underground (Tube) operates a subway from Piccadilly Circus station to South Kensington station every 5 minutes. Tickets cost £1–6 and the journey takes 8 min.
